Office中国论坛/Access中国论坛

标题: 一个窗体删除事件的处理 [打印本页]

作者: zshowell    时间: 2006-10-29 23:32
标题: 一个窗体删除事件的处理
我有一个含子窗体的ACCESS程序



主窗体中有一字段 "已收数量"就是将子窗体中对应的数量合计起来

每次对子窗体的数量作增改时,通过

Form_订胚单子窗体.已收数量 = Round((0 + DSum("[仓库收料].[数量]", "[仓库收料]", "[所属部份]=" & Form_订胚单子窗体.编号)), 2)

都能得到正确结果,但存在另一问题,当子窗体中做了删除记录动作后

不能即时到正确的"已收数量" 情况就是在执行Private Sub Form_Delete(Cancel As Integer)

时,当时的数据集还未有更新为删除后的数据,而是删除前的数据,

更令我不解的是,以前我做过类似的事件时,却又不会这样的,有朋友试过吗?




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3